Output 51f477ce0939eb33227688244efc43766f820d7cdfc99a42743c7186630aa409:0

value
2809887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0982ecf418295c27514367740258d7e798ac010b OP_EQUAL
address
32ZJr96SfZsARXLYJ4yqbsT5Pp7QdGzbnH
transaction
51f477ce0939eb33227688244efc43766f820d7cdfc99a42743c7186630aa409
confirmations
404372
spent
true